Best Dishes Eater Editors Ate This Week | Eater LA

"In the Inland Empire Flavor Season’s Backyard Classic smash burger keeps things intentionally simple and delicious — a heavily seared, crusty burger married with pickles, chopped onions, American cheese, and sauce — making it a reliable suburban standout even if the strip-mall setting lacks ambiance." - Eater Staff

Was in the plaza to go to the urgent care and my son asked if we could try this place. We did and WOW!! Truly the best burger I've ever had! The staff was super friendly to begin with, answering ingredient questions to ensure I would be able to stick to my keto diet. So I ordered the smashroom burger, with no mild pepper spread, and no bun, my son ordered the chimichurri steak panini, and my husband ordered the cilantro lime bowl with chicken. They got the smoky mac to share. My burger was soooooo delicious! Comes with angus beef, sautéed mushrooms & red onions in creamy garlic butter sauce, havarti cheese. I ordered the double patty and shared with my hubby and son. They agreed on how good it was. But even so, they said they really liked what they ordered, too. My son thinks the smoky mac should be renamed bayou mac - and I agree! It has creamy four cheese macaroni and cheese, plus shrimp, smoked sausage, bell peppers. Give this place a try - you won't be sorry. As for us, we live 15 minutes away but I think we'll be regulars, including possibly going back tonight!

First thing you notice is how clean and open the place is. Seating both outside and inside, with open space and counter like seating with a large TV. Was greeted immediately by Nash who asked me if I had any questions about the menu. I let him know that I couldn’t decide between the cheesesteak and bbq rib sandwich. He gave me the breakdown and I went with the rib sandwich just because it was kinda unique and I imagined an elevated McRib sandwich, which was ended up being pretty accurate. Really enjoyed the sandwich, but then again, I am a McRib fan as well. Fries were cooked well and tasty. Could have been a little crispier, but then again, I ended up taking my order to go and could have been the commute. My gf got the cilantro lime bowl and really enjoyed it, but I didn’t get a chance to taste it because I was so full from my dish. We shared the spicy corn and agree with many others that it’s a great side dish. A little sweet and a little spicy. My gf added some extra Mayo at home, but it was just fine the way it was for me. Great service and food is all anyone can really ask for these days and Flavor Season hit all the marks. Will have to go back and try the cheesesteak, chimichurri steak and a smash burger! Will update my review accordingly!

Was excited to try the food based on the pictures but was a bit underwhelming when trying the food. I got togo and didn’t have a problem ordering and picking up my order at all. It was first a bit hard to find at night, with the light of the restaurant sign not turned on. Food So I decided to order a few items. I can give feedback based on what I ordered : Cilantro Lime Chicken Bowl- the only compliment I would say about this was the chicken seemed to be well marinated, and quite tasty. The inside of the Bowl was what was I believe a bit underwhelming. It had a lot of rice, some unseasoned diced tomatoes and diced onions. Smokey Mac and Cheese- I was actually looking forward to this, but I would say this was just mediocre. It did have a few bits of shrimp and bacon, but it was a bit dry on the top, and maybe it was because I did get it togo. Smashroom - this has good flavor but I believe it was missing more vegetables or something to keep the burger moist. The bun was a bit too soft. Again not sure if this was just because I got togo. I believe with just a few of these items the price may have been a bit high. It cost me $38 for just these items, and I guess I just expected more bang for the buck. I think I would rather stop by a local Habit Burger and get a juicer burger.
